The abandoned Tube station swallowed Detective Harlow Quinn whole. Fluorescent work lights cast harsh shadows across cracked tile and decades of accumulated grime, transforming the underground space into a clinical landscape of forensic investigation. Her boots echoed against ceramic and concrete, each step measured and precise. Three bodies lay arranged in a triangular formation, limbs carefully positioned like pieces on a ritualistic chessboard. Quinn's sharp jaw clenched as she surveyed the scene, her salt-and-pepper hair catching the artificial light. Something felt deliberately staged about the arrangement—too perfect, too calculated. "Thoughts?" she asked, not turning toward her colleague. Eva Kowalski pushed her round glasses up the bridge of her nose, leather satchel tucked close to her body. Her curly red hair was pulled back, freckled hands gloved in thin latex. "Symmetry matters here," she murmured, more to herself than Quinn. "Look at the positioning. Equilateral triangle. Precise angles." Quinn's worn leather watch caught her peripheral vision as she crouched, examining the first body. Male, mid-thirties, no obvious wounds. Pale skin with an unusual bluish undertone. Her brown eyes narrowed. "Not a typical homicide," she said flatly. Eva tucked a stray curl behind her left ear—her telltale nervous gesture. "Definitely not. These markings..." She pointed to subtle sigil-like patterns barely visible on the victims' exposed skin. The underground chamber felt thick with something beyond mere murder—a weight of intention, of deliberate design. The abandoned Tube station, normally a forgotten artery beneath Camden's bustling streets, now felt like a sealed ritual space. Quinn's military precision guided her movements. She photographed each body, noting minute details: positioning of hands, direction of feet, the subtle variations in skin tone and muscular tension. Something here didn't align with standard forensic expectations. "These aren't random victims," Quinn muttered. "They were selected." Eva nodded, pulling a worn notebook from her satchel. "The triangulation suggests a summoning geometry. But summoning what?" The detective's instincts, honed through eighteen years of metropolitan policing, whispered that this crime scene connected to something larger. Something that might relate to her partner's unexplained disappearance three years earlier. She pulled out a small brass compass from her jacket pocket—a curious artifact she'd acquired during a previous investigation. Its verdigris-covered surface caught the light, protective sigils etched across its face. The needle trembled, then spun wildly before settling in an unexpected direction. "Eva," Quinn said quietly, "this isn't a typical murder investigation." The research assistant's green eyes met Quinn's, a shared understanding passing between them. Whatever had happened in this forgotten Underground station was part of a larger, more complex puzzle—one that would require more than standard police procedure to unravel.
